
数据模型的基本概念
数据模型用来抽象、表示和处理现实世界中的数据和信息。分为两个阶段:把现实世界中的客观对象抽象为概念模型;把概念模型转换为某一DBMS支持的数据模型。
数据模型所描述的内容有3个部分,它们是数据结构、数据操作与数据约束。
E-R模型
1.E-R模型的基本概念
(1)实体:现实世界中的事物可以抽象成为实体,实体是概念世界中的基本单位,它们是客观存在的且又能相互区别的事物。
(2)属性:现实世界中事物均有一些特性,这些特性可以用属性来表示。
(3)码:标识实体的属性集称为码。
(4)域:属性的取值范围称为该属性的域。
(5)联系:在现实世界中事物间的关联称为联系。
两个实体集间的联系实际上是实体集间的函数关系,这种函数关系可以有下面几种:一对一的联系、一对多或多对一联系、多对多。
2.E-R模型的图示法
E-R模型用E-R图来表示。
(1)实体表示法:在E-R图中用矩形表示实体集,在矩形内写上该实体集的名字。
(2)属性表示法:在E-R图中用椭圆形表示属性,在椭圆形内写上该属性的名称。
(3)联系表示法:在E-R图中用菱形表示联系,菱形内写上联系名。
层次模型
满足下面两个条件的基本层次联系的集合为层次模型。
(1)有且只有一个结点没有双亲结点,这个结点称为根结点;
(2)除根结点以外的其他结点有且仅有一个双亲结点。
2016年计算机二级考试公共基础考点知识:数据模型的基本概念.doc正在阅读:
2016年计算机二级考试公共基础考点知识:数据模型的基本概念05-03
财务主管个人求职简历【三篇】08-02
冲刺英语四级高分:短篇新闻听力解题技巧05-20
2019年1月四川西昌学院编制外招聘公告【44人】09-08
幼儿园小班科学教案范文:气味真正多11-10
澳大利亚留学热门专业排名前十的院校盘点10-18
2022广东省珠海市斗门区人力资源和社会保障局招聘雇员公告05-18
小学生想象作文丛林探险记500字【五篇】12-05
[电商实训报告总结范文带目录]2016电商实训总结范文08-30
2023年湖南永州祁阳中考志愿填报时间及入口[6月9日至6月17日]05-31
2019年甘肃天水中考物理答案(已公布)03-30